Hope is Always an Option
God is present with us in every instance. He holds hope before us. And He will be there on the other side of our trauma waiting for us. The light is ahead. We only need to hang in there and keep doing what is necessary and endure as long as we need to.
Victory is ahead.
During times of intense pressure, I have found comfort in the Scriptures. As I do, I hope you find comfort in this promise:
“Fear not, I have redeemed you; I have called you by your name; you are Mine. When you pass through the waters, I will be with you; and through the rivers, they shall not overflow you. When you walk through the fire, you shall not be burned. Nor shall the flame scorch you” (Isaiah 43:1-2).
